Illustrated Encyclopedia of Native American Mounds & Earthworks—3rd Edition- New
The sacred sites and enormous earthworks associated with them are one of the most unappreciated archaeological treasures in the world. Sites are arranged alphabetically by state and include: Archaic sites, Adena culture sites, Hopewell earthworks and mounds, and Mississippian sites.
